El Centro Naval Air Facility
El Centro Naval Air Facility has lower-than-average household income, with a median household income of $69,063. Population has declined 11% since 2023. Renters pay a median $1,741 per month, above the US median of $1,442. At a median age of 22.7, residents skew younger than the country as a whole. Poverty is rare here, at 0.0% of residents. Households here earn about 30% less than the California median.

How many people live in El Centro Naval Air Facility, California?
El Centro Naval Air Facility, California has about 443 residents according to the 2024 American Community Survey.
What is the median household income in El Centro Naval Air Facility, California?
The typical household in El Centro Naval Air Facility, California earns about $69,063 a year. Half of households make more than that, and half make less.
Is El Centro Naval Air Facility, California expensive?
In El Centro Naval Air Facility, California, the typical rent is about $1,741 a month.
How educated are people in El Centro Naval Air Facility, California?
About 26.5% of adults age 25 and over in El Centro Naval Air Facility, California hold a bachelor's degree or higher.
What is the poverty rate in El Centro Naval Air Facility, California?
About 0.0% of people in El Centro Naval Air Facility, California live below the federal poverty line.
